// defineConfig comes from vitest/config rather than vite so the `test` block
// below type-checks; it is vite's own, widened with Vitest's options.
import { defineConfig } from 'vitest/config'
import react from '@vitejs/plugin-react'
import tailwindcss from '@tailwindcss/vite'
// The Python server owns /api. In dev, Vite serves the UI on :5173 and proxies
// API + SSE calls through to uvicorn on :8765 so both share one origin.
export default defineConfig({
plugins: [react(), tailwindcss()],
server: {
port: 5173,
proxy: {
'/api': {
target: 'http://127.0.0.1:8765',
changeOrigin: true,
// Server-sent events must not be buffered by the proxy.
configure: (proxy) => {
proxy.on('proxyRes', (proxyRes) => {
if (proxyRes.headers['content-type']?.includes('text/event-stream')) {
delete proxyRes.headers['content-length']
}
})
},
},
},
},
build: {
outDir: 'dist',
emptyOutDir: true,
chunkSizeWarningLimit: 900,
},
test: {
environment: 'jsdom',
globals: true,
setupFiles: ['./src/test/setup.ts'],
// Only our own tests; node_modules and the built bundle are not ours.
include: ['src/**/*.test.{ts,tsx}'],
},
})
